Study on Bearing Capacity of Belled Uplift Piles in Soft Clay Area

The study on the bearing capacity characteristics of the belled uplift piles in soft clay foundation is of guiding significance for the type selection and bearing performance of the piles. A full-scale test on the uplift piles in soft clay was carried out in Qianhai District of Shenzhen. The test results show that the belled uplift piles are applicable to the soft clay. Compared with the equal section uplift piles, the Q-S curves are smoother, the ultimate bearing capacity can be increased by more than 50%, and the piles perform more stability in the later stage of the test. The displacement of pile foundation, the elongation of pile body and the rebound ratio of pile foundation are studied. The results show that the foundation with the belled uplift piles are applicable in the soft clay areas, and the small-angle belled uplift pile head suitable for the soft clay area is proposed, which is of great significance for the popularization and use of the belled uplift piles.
